ADINKRA-05

Russell Watson

Adinkra-05 is a convergence of submerged worlds and ancient symbolic systems. Composed from underwater photographs taken during free-diving expeditions and layered with digitally rendered portraiture, the image positions a humanoid presence within swirling constellations of marine organisms, particulate matter and luminous geometries. Across the figure’s skin, photographs of living coral are meticulously overlaid, so that the body appears encrusted, coated and grown over by reef structures – as if human flesh and marine habitat were momentarily indistinguishable. The composition recalls the devotional symmetry of Tibetan thangka paintings, yet its cosmology is distinctly oceanic and Afro-diasporic, animated by breath, suspension and spirit.

The title refers to Adinkra – visual symbols originating among the Akan peoples of West Africa, each carrying philosophical concepts related to community, resilience, memory and continuity. Here, ancestral sign systems are reimagined through code and projection, transforming symbolic inheritance into a moving, immersive environment. The work stages an encounter between deep time and digital time, asking how inherited knowledge might circulate through contemporary image-making and expanded states of perception.
